버려진 나의 최애를 위하여 [Beoryeojin Na-eui Choeaereul Wihayeo]

Rate this book
N차 정주행을 했을 정도로 좋아한 로판 소설에 빙의했다.
평민이지만 돈 많은 평민의 몸에 빙의한 덕분에,
나는 몰락 귀족의 신분을 사 귀족가의 연회를 다니며 원작 속 인물들의 로맨스를 관전했다.

그렇게 엔딩까지 보고 현실로 돌아가나 싶었는데…….
웬걸, 엔딩 후에도 빙의에서 풀려나지 않고 원작 속에서의 인생을 살게 되었다.
그러다 보니 알고 싶지 않은 비하인드 이야기까지 알게 되어 버렸다.
내 최애인 서브남 카엘루스가 죽어 버린 것이다.

그가 없는 원작 속에서 피폐하게 살아가던 나는 결국 병이 들어 죽음을 맞이했다.
이제 현실로 돌아가나 싶더니, 무슨 운명의 장난인지 하루아침에 소설 엔딩 직후로 회귀했다.
이건 분명…… 내 최애를 살리라는 뜻이겠지?

A fangirl transmigrates into a novel she has read multiple times as commoner Hestia who has not involvement in the plot. She spends her money to buy a title so she can observe the main characters from afar. A year passes and Diana marries the Crown Prince Helios. Only the conclusion of the book events does not return her home and she quickly discovers that events after the end of the ro-fan were awful. Her favorite character, the second male lead Caelus, kills himself after being rejected by the saintess, the main couple live unhappily, the emperor dies, and war threatens the empire. Hestia struggles for a year before she curses the author/god and collapses from poor health. This resets her to the end of the novel and she rushes off to make changes. Hestia saves her bias, becoming his wife on paper and promising to make the main couple realize their actions and apologize. She pretends to have prophetic visions of the future, re-establishes the Marquis’s honor, and manipulates high society in the name of getting Caelus a happy ending.
* * * * *-----------------* * * * *-----------------* * * * *
Honestly, I avoided this Korean work for a time because there was some hostility about how it handled suicidality in reviews. And it is a plot device more than a mental health issue as presented. However, overall, this revenge themed isekai adventure doesn’t take 2,000 chapters to tell its story. The narrative requires the characters to be rather shallow to play off one another. One is a naïve idealist who refuses to compromise, one is an opportunist whose title blocks serious repercussions for his actions, and another is detached and oblivious for most of the runtime. They don’t feel real but this intentionally saves time, better represents cliché archetypes, and add excitement to events that would not come from calm/rational players. It doesn’t resolve all conflicts or moral quandaries. The romance is rather weak overall, tinged with toxic behavior patterns. *Spoiler Alert* Kael saves Diana when she never actually regrets her behavior undermining Hestia’s work… but that moment evolves into a discussion on reader’s emotions and projections onto a story which remains worthwhile even if you are unhappy with the specific choices. It’s not particularly earth-shattering for the genre but these moments of reflection or little details do help keep my opinion of it favorable.
